These will be the hours in which the Pisawill finally make official the name of the sporting director and the coach who will lead the Nerazzurri team in the next Serie B season after the farewells of Stefano Stefanelli And Alberto Aquilani.

Roles for which the choices have already been made, with the ex Modena Davide Vaira behind the desk and Filippo Inzaghi on the bench.

These appointments will reduce the number of clubs in the cadet tournament to two without a First Team leader yet: this is the Catanzaro he was born in Frosinone.
